Supporting weight loss naturally can be a transformative journey, allowing you to shed unwanted pounds without resorting to extreme diets or rigorous workout regimes. An approach that is gentle and sustainable can yield better long-term results and help you maintain a healthy lifestyle. Here are several effective strategies to consider.
Firstly, focus on nutrition. Rather than cutting out entire food groups or counting every calorie, aim for a balanced diet rich in whole foods. Fill your plate with plenty of f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ats. Whole foods are not only more nutritious but also promote satiety, meaning they can help you feel fuller for longer. Incorporating foods high in fiber, such as oats, beans, and leafy greens, can also aid digestion and make your meals more satisfying, reducing the temptation to snack mindlessly.
Hydration plays a crucial role in weight management. Water is essential for various bodily functions, including metabolism. Sometimes, our bodies can misinterpret thirst for hunger, leading to unnecessary eating. Aim to drink water throughout the day and consider starting meals with a glass of water, as this can aid digestion and help regulate portion sizes.
Another effective strategy involves mindful eating. This practice encourages individuals to slow down and pay attention to their eating experience, from the textures and flavors of the food to the sensations of fullness. Eating mindfully can reduce overeating, help you develop a healthier relationship with food, and allow you to truly enjoy your meals. It can be beneficial to eat without distractions, such as television or smartphones, to foster greater awareness and appreciation of what you’re consuming.
Sleep is often an overlooked aspect of weight loss. Lack of sleep can disrupt hormonal balance, increase appetite, and lead to cravings for high-calorie foods. Aim to establish a regular sleep schedule that allows for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night. Creating a relaxing bedtime routine can help improve your sleep quality, which in turn can support your weight loss efforts.
Incorporating physical activity into your daily routine doesn’t have to be about hitting the gym for intense workouts. Focus on incorporating more movement into your day-to-day life. Simple changes like taking the stairs instead of the elevator, walking during your lunch break, or dancing while doing household chores can significantly increase your activity level. Finding activities you genuinely enjoy, whether it’s hiking, swimming, or playing a sport, can make exercise feel less like a chore and more like a fun part of your life.
Stress management is another essential element of supporting weight loss naturally. High stress levels can trigger emotional eating and lead to weight gain. Techniques such as meditation, yoga, or even just taking time for hobbies can help reduce stress. Finding ways to relax and unwind can prevent the cycle of stress and overeating.
